Tara
The name Tara, originating from Sanskrit, holds immense spiritual significance within Buddhist traditions, particularly in Tibetan Buddhism. Meaning "star," "savior," or "she who guides across," Tara is revered as a female Bodhisattva, a Buddha of compassion and enlightened activity. She is often depicted in various forms, such as Green Tara, symbolizing swift action and protection, and White Tara, representing long life and healing. Her presence offers solace and guidance, helping beings navigate the ocean of suffering towards liberation.
